How You'll Make a Difference

Valvoline has a rewarding opportunity as a Cyber Security Intern. As an intern, you will support the Cyber Security team in protecting the organization's systems and data from threats. Responsibilities include assisting with security monitoring, incident response, documentation, and automation of detection and response workflows. This internship provides hands-on experience in cybersecurity and exposure to industry-leading tools and practices


This position is located in Lexington, KY.

  •  Assist in automating detection and response workflows (e.g., scripting, tool integration)
  • Monitor security alerts and logs, escalate potential threats
  • Help maintain and update security documentation and playbooks
  • Support incident response activities, including investigation and documentation
  • Participate in red team activities (e.g., simulated attacks, testing defenses)
